Somewhere there is a formula that none of us have. That is the actual break even factor for the hotels.

In the good ole days of 5,6, or 7 ago, the rooms were full and the tables were full. Not only did the resorts make money, they made A LOT of money. So much so, they could expand, create unimaginable sights, build high end suites, gaming areas, and restaurants, and still buy other profitable casinos.

Granted the money isn't flowing in like it once did. OTOH, what would it take for Caesars Palace to support the bills of Caesars Palace, or Sam"s Town to pay the Sam's Town bills, or Wynn income to exceed Wynn expenses?

I think that the individual hotels can support themselves much better than the conglomerates can support their top heavy management. And I hope this leads to massive sell off, more competition, and casinos working hard to get the consumer in their doors. If the focus changed to customer service instead of wow factor, I think that things would improve faster.

Is now the time to buy LV casino stocks?

Here are a couple of experts' opinions on the subject matter. (The interpretations of the experts' opinions are my own so please feel free to rebel or offer contrary opinions of your own.

Fact #1: Both the Wynn and the Venetian have big investments in Macau which initially helped to offset some of the financial difficulties that they were both experiencing in Las Vegas.

Their success in Macau is of extreme importance to both these gambling companies.

BUT ... due to the fact that China's citizens have lost way too much money in Macau, the Chinese government has initiated travel restrictions which now only allow China's citizens to travel to Macau a maximum of once every three months resulting in a 10% drop in gaming revenues for the third quarter of 2008.

Fact #2: Competition via new casinos that will be built on a group of beautiful islands of Penghu, which lies in the Taiwan Strait between Taiwan and the east coast of China. And new casino development in Singapore.

This casino expansion throughout the Orient can be compared to the the rise of the Indian casinos in California which are taking the business away from the Reno and Lake Tahoe casinos.

"Build it and they will come!" still holds true a bit, but the one who builds it closer will steal their gambling dollars!.

Casino stocks are presently cheap because their profits are disappearing.

Americans and Asians have dramatically cut back on their gambling forays and until that changes the value of these stocks will still stay low.

RECENT REPORT FROM THE LV JOURNAL - Profits for Nevada casinos fell 69 percent in the last fiscal year that ended June 30, according to a report from the Nevada Gaming Control Board.
